When you use the first Qt Installation method. Doing make xconfig in the kernel directory results in:
Unable to find the QT installation. Please make sure that the
- QT development package is correctly installed and the QTDIR
- environment variable is set to the correct location. * make[1]: * [scripts/kconfig/.tmp_qtcheck] Error 1 make: * [xconfig] Error 2
This might go for other programs that depend on qt though I'm not sure.
I've done some reasearch and have found it's because the first method "is slightly non-standard I think, the standard is to have all of qt (libs, bins and includes) under the general path $QTDIR"
